Performance neo4j非常缓慢地对一个节点的所有数据进行计数

Performance neo4j非常缓慢地对一个节点的所有数据进行计数,performance,neo4j,Performance,Neo4j,我有一个名为Event的节点,它告诉我如何放置web门户执行的所有事件 现在我有150万个活动 因此,当我计算事件数时,我执行以下查询: MATCH (e:Event) RETURN count(e) AS numberOfEvent 但是它非常慢:25000毫秒 在经典的SGBD(如Postgres)中,同样的查询在200毫秒内执行 这是正常的还是我的查询写得不正确 问候 Olivier这是您第一次运行查询吗?你能再运行一次吗 我认为postgres存储总计数,而neo将实际加载数据。 因此

我有一个名为Event的节点,它告诉我如何放置web门户执行的所有事件

现在我有150万个活动

因此,当我计算事件数时,我执行以下查询:

MATCH (e:Event) RETURN count(e) AS numberOfEvent
但是它非常慢:25000毫秒

在经典的SGBD(如Postgres)中,同样的查询在200毫秒内执行

这是正常的还是我的查询写得不正确

问候
Olivier这是您第一次运行查询吗?你能再运行一次吗

我认为postgres存储总计数,而neo将实际加载数据。 因此,您需要测量加载数据的磁盘速度

我们将通过在内部为此类查询使用数据库统计数据来改进这一点